Following his arrest by men of the Akwa Ibom State Police Command for allegedly defiling a 16-year-old girl, Nollywood actor and singer, Moses Armstrong has officially been suspended by the Actors Guild of Nigeria.
Actress Monalisa Chinda Coker confirmed the development by posting a statement of the suspension.
According to the statement, signed by Emeka Rollas,, who is the national president of the Actors Guild of Nigeria, Moses Armstrong has been placed on an indefinite suspension following facts that emanated from the investigation of the case and that if he goes against the suspension rules, disciplinary measures will be stipulated.
Earlier, the national president of the Actors Guild of Nigeria, Emeka Rollas, confirmed Armstrong’s arrest during a chat with Qed.ng.
Rollas described the case as “a very serious one”.
He said it is being handled by the First Lady of the state, Martha Udom Emmanuel through her Family Empowerment and Youth Re-Orientation Path Initiative.
The AGN president added that the organisation will not condone such a crime.
